Task 2: WritingTopic: "Is society becoming more or less dependent on technology?"


In this task, you are asked to take a position on whether modern society is increasingly reliant on technology. You will need to provide reasons and examples to support your argument. It's essential to consider both the positive and negative aspects of this trend.

Model Answer:

"Society has become increasingly dependent on technology in recent years, due to a combination of factors including the rapid advancements in technology, the convenience it offers, and its impact on various aspects of life. However, while these developments have brought about numerous benefits, they also pose significant challenges that need to be addressed.

Firstly, the speed at which technology is evolving has led to a growing reliance on it. Technological advancements such as smartphones, the internet, and artificial intelligence have transformed the way we communicate, access information, and carry out daily tasks. This integration of technology into our lives has made it difficult for people to function without these tools.

Secondly, technology offers convenience in various forms. For instance, online shopping allows us to purchase goods from anywhere at any time, while GPS systems help us navigate unfamiliar places. Additionally, technology has revolutionized the way we receive medical care and education. For example, telemedicine allows patients to consult with doctors remotely, while e-learning platforms have made accessing educational resources more accessible.

Despite these benefits, excessive reliance on technology comes with its share of problems. One major concern is the potential impact on mental health. The constant use of devices such as smartphones and computers can lead to increased stress levels, anxiety, and addiction. Furthermore, this overreliance on technology has caused a decline in critical thinking skills and face-to-face communication.

Another challenge posed by technological advancements is the potential for job displacement. Automation and artificial intelligence have already replaced many jobs, with more expected to be affected in the future. This shift raises questions about the role of humans in the workforce and the need for re-skilling programs to equip individuals with the necessary skills to adapt to these changes.

In conclusion, while technology has undoubtedly made our lives more convenient and connected, it is important to recognize its potential drawbacks. Society must find a balance between embracing the benefits of technology and ensuring that we do not become overly dependent on it. By doing so, we can harness the power of innovation without sacrificing the essential aspects of human life."

For Task Response: Band Score - 7
- The candidate has provided a well-structured response with a clear thesis statement, appropriate organization, and logical development of ideas. The response demonstrates a good control of language and an extensive vocabulary range, although there are minor errors affecting clarity.

For Coherence and Cohesion: Band Score - 7
- The candidate has demonstrated a high level of coherence and cohesion in the essay. The paragraph structure is well-organized and clearly linked to support the thesis statement. However, some minor errors or inappropriate connections between sentences slightly affect the overall flow of ideas.

For Lexical Resource: Band Score - 7
- The candidate has shown a good range of vocabulary and accurate usage of word forms in the response. There are a few inaccuracies or less common collocations that may slightly affect clarity but do not impede understanding.

For Grammatical Range and Accuracy: Band Score - 7
- The candidate's grammar is generally accurate, with only minor errors that occasionally affect the clarity of the text. There are some instances of incorrect or inappropriate tense usage, as well as a few misplaced modifiers, which slightly impact sentence clarity but do not hinder overall comprehension.
